There are three Temperature Check Tools that you, as a leader, can complete:
Culture of Belonging Temperature Check - Roadmap
  • The Leadership Style and Strategy Reflective Learning Tool helps you identify your strengths and gaps so you can BE the change as you facilitate change. 
  • The Workplace Team Reflective Learning Tool helps you identify your next best step for building belonging in your team.
  • The Social Change Strategy Reflective Learning Tool helps you identify where to focus your efforts to address your most pressing people problems and facilitate change in your organization.
We recommend you start with the Leadership Style and Strategy Reflective Learning Tool. However, if you have pressing team or organizational challenges, feel free to begin with any of the Temperature Check Tools.
